Protecting UX with Feature Policy

Modus Create

Modern applications use Feature Policy to: Enforce permissions. Feature policies can help control such access. Feature policies can also help guardrail performance by denying access to such code. For maximum effectiveness, use Feature Policies in development environments to enforce the contract early on.
